I have recently concluded a search and buy with a requirement for a very small camera that is silent in operation, Good IQ and Zoom.

It came down the the RX100ii and GM1 and I eventually chose the GM1.

I am more then impressed with the beautifully made device with quite frankly astonishing picture quality, even with the unexpectedly sharp 12-32mm. Will write more on this later.

However for now I have decide to get a few prime lenses with good light gathering.

I have to decide between the 15mm f1.7 and 20mm f1.7 ii as a mild wide choice.

I also want one other for 70-100mm (I tend to shoot at either 35mmish or longer then 70mm - not much in between!.

The 42.5mm f1.2 Panasonic seems sublime and looks good with the GM1 (black) but is slightly unbalanced.

I wonder whether anyone has shot with this combination and can comment (or actually any other larger then normal lens on the GM1 regularly)

I've used the GM1 with the 42.5mm f1.2 and also the 100-300m and its fine. You tend to support via the lens rather than the camera.

I sometimes shoot my GM1 with the Olympus 75mm which is kinda large as well. It's a little akward... and kinda defeats the purpose of the "small size" but its definitely doable. I do have a gariz case on my GM1 which gives it a better grip.

My favorite combo with the GM1 is the 20mm and 45mm. I feel like those are a perfect match for the GM1. But now that the 15mm is coming, perhaps size wise the 15mm is better.

I also found this review with the GM1 and Nocticron:

''While the lens overwhelms the diminutive Panasonic GM1, it is surprisingly light given its solid, metal barrel and lens hood. It matches the styling of the GX7 and GH3 perfectly, and feels very balanced. Despite the size difference, it was a pleasure to use on the smaller GM1.''

I've got the GM1 with the P14, P20, and O45. Also the Richard Franiec grip on the GM1. It all balances very well. In my opinion, you don't get a GM1 unless size is a major priority, and if size is a major priority you don't get the P42 instead of the O45.

I've tried the Nocticron on the GM1 (I have the Franiec grip)...and while "doable"...it's a bit ridiculous...the 45mm is a much better pairing IMO. That being said...can't beat that yummy rendering.
